This is a comprehensive collection of methods and protocols for Drosophila, one of the oldest and most commonly used model organisms in modern biology. The protocols are written by the scientists who invented the methods making this book the perfect reference manual for Drosophila researchers. The straightforward presentation of Drosophila protocols will bolster successful experimental design and lead to reproducible results, and the troubleshooting tips are an invaluable aid for researchers at all levels. This book will advance the use of Drosophila as a model organism by collecting standard, introductory protocols and advanced protocols, simultaneously providing a platform for introductory research and facilitation advanced study. The text presents a diverse set of techniques that range from the basic handling of flies to more complex applications. Review chapters provide concise overviews of selected experimental systems.
